Result: Would you buy again? Definitely
Comment:
Just a brilliant all round tyre for the price point, been using them on my VW and parents cars for a good few years, mileage out them is not great if you drive on the limit all the time, but they inspire that as they grip very will in the dry and the wet, as per usual Cooper tyres have always been good on british roast with typical british weather - Also part of the Avon tyre lot, associated Chinese brands are Superia, Austone, Fortune etc, if it's B or A rated for wet you can almost guarantee it to be the case these days.
